Sony denies 40GB PS3 failure rate

Sony Computer Entertainment Europe has denied allegations claiming that the new 40GB PlayStation 3 model carries a 40% failure rate, as recently reported on a Dutch website.

Speaking in an official statement today, SCEE President David Reeves commented, “We are very proud of the quality and reliability of PLAYSTATION 3 and are disappointed that such extremely sloppy journalism has resulted in this totally inaccurate story.”

“Since launching the 40GB PS3, we have experienced a fantastic jump in sales and the failure rates have remained at the very low level that we not only strive for, but have been achieving since the launch of PS3.”

The 40GB PS3 launched across Europe on October 10, with the model later arriving in North America on November 2.
